About Restaurante Mangai
Restaurante Mangai is a Brazilian buffet restaurant in João Pessoa, State of Paraíba, known for regional and Northeastern food served in an all-you-can-eat buffet format. Reviewers consistently praise the wide variety of dishes, especially carne-de-sol, cocada, buchada de bode, and other local specialties from Paraíba and Brazil. The atmosphere is described as casual, cozy, and rooted in Northeastern Brazilian decor and music. It is popular for breakfast, lunch, dinner, and solo dining, and reservations are recommended for lunch and dinner.

Frequently asked questions
What is Restaurante Mangai known for?
It is best known for its regional Northeastern Brazilian buffet, especially carne-de-sol, cocada, and other local dishes from Paraíba. Reviewers repeatedly mention the huge variety, with many saying you can build a plate from dozens of savory and sweet options.
What dishes are most recommended at Restaurante Mangai?
Reviewers most often highlight carne-de-sol, cocada, buchada de bode, cartola, and the buffet’s vegetable sides and stews. The pomegranate juice also gets specific praise, with one review saying the pitcher was worth ordering because a single glass was not enough.
What is the atmosphere like at Restaurante Mangai?
The vibe is casual, cozy, and a little upscale, with rustic wooden tables, vibrant artwork, and relaxed music that reviewers say evokes Northeastern Brazil. It works well for groups and tourists, and the large buffet setup also makes it comfortable for solo diners who want to try many dishes.
Is Restaurante Mangai good value? What is the price range?
The listed price range is R$40–120, and reviews say it can feel pricey for João Pessoa, especially if you load up on many buffet items. Even so, people often call the buffet-by-weight system fair because you can choose exactly what you want and the drinks are described as reasonable.
How does the buffet system work at Restaurante Mangai?
Mangai uses a buffet-by-weight format, where your food is weighed and you pay based on what you take, with one review noting a charge of 99 reais per kilo. Guests also mention getting a card on entry that tracks the weight, and that there are over 100 items to choose from.
